vimarsana.com
Home
Steve Super Gardens
Top Locations Tagged with Steve Super Gardens
Steve Super Gardens in United States - /Retail-company near baywood-los-osos/Retail-company near San Luis Obispo
1). Steve Super Gardens
Steve Super Gardens in United States - 93402/Retail-company near baywood-los-osos/Retail-company near San Luis Obispo
2). Steve Super Gardens San Luis Obispo Ca United States
Steve Super Gardens in United States - 06153/Garden near Hartford
3). Steve Super Gardens, Th St
vimarsana © 2020. All Rights Reserved.